Article Title: Reprogramming the pluripotent cell cycle: restoration of an abbreviated G1 phase in human induced pluripotent stem (iPS) cells
doi: 10.1002/jcp.22440
Figure Lengend Snippet: Biochemical analysis of synchronized human iPS (A6 and D1), hES (H9) and/or fibroblasts cells (TIG1) corroborate the finding that human iPS cells have an abbreviated G1 phase. (A) The relative RNA expression of cell cycle indicators; histone H4, Cyclin E2, Cyclin B2, HINFP and p220NPAT was analyzed using mRNA isolated from actively proliferating and nocodazole synchronized human iPS (asynchronous [Asy], 0h [G2/M], 2h [G1] and 4h [early S] after release) and hES cells (asynchronous [Asy], 0h [G2/M], 1.5h [G1] and 4h [early S] after release). (B) For comparison, the relative RNA expression of some of the cell cycle indicators; histone H4, Cyclin E2, Cyclin B2, HINFP and p220NPAT was analyzed in actively proliferating and nocodazole synchronized human normal fibroblasts TIG1 (asynchronous [Asy], 0h [mitosis-M], 6h [G1] and 16h [S] after release). (C) Protein expression analysis of human iPS (A6 and D1) and hES (H9) for cell cycle indicators (Cyclin E2, Cyclin B2 and HINFP) also reveals rapid entry into S-phase. (D) FACS analysis of synchronized human iPS (A6) and hES (H9) cells shows that within 2–3 h after exit from mitosis cells enter S-phase.
